Apache安全漏洞如何修复?有哪些最新防护措施?

Apache作为全球使用最广泛的Web服务器软件之一,其安全性直接关系到众多网站和应用的稳定运行,由于代码复杂度高、功能模块丰富以及持续的外部威胁,Apache安全漏洞时有发生,需引起管理员的高度重视,本文将围绕Apache常见安全漏洞类型、影响范围、防护措施及应急响应策略展开分析,帮助构建更安全的Web服务环境。

Apache安全漏洞如何修复?有哪些最新防护措施?

Apache常见安全漏洞类型及风险分析

Apache安全漏洞主要可分为代码执行、权限绕过、信息泄露、拒绝服务等几大类,不同漏洞的利用难度和潜在影响差异较大。

代码执行漏洞

此类漏洞允许攻击者在服务器上执行任意代码,危害等级最高,早期的Apache Struts2框架中的“OGNL表达式注入”漏洞(如CVE-2017-5638),攻击者可通过恶意请求触发远程代码执行,完全控制服务器,Apache HTTP Server的模块(如mod_php、mod_perl)若配置不当,也可能导致本地代码执行风险。

权限绕过漏洞

权限绕过漏洞可使攻击者越权访问受限资源,Apache 2.4.49版本中的路径穿越漏洞(CVE-2021-41773),攻击者通过构造恶意请求可绕过目录限制,读取服务器任意文件;若结合CVE-2021-41774漏洞,甚至可能实现远程代码执行,此类漏洞通常源于对用户输入的校验不足或路径解析逻辑缺陷。

信息泄露漏洞

信息泄露可能暴露服务器敏感信息,如版本号、目录结构、配置参数等,Apache默认配置下的“目录列表”功能若未禁用,攻击者可获取目录下的文件列表;错误页面可能包含堆栈跟踪信息,为攻击者提供进一步攻击的线索。

拒绝服务(DoS)漏洞

DoS漏洞通过消耗服务器资源(如CPU、内存、带宽)导致服务不可用,Apache HTTP Server的“HTTP请求走私”漏洞(CVE-2021-41773)可被利用构造恶意请求,导致服务器进程崩溃;而“Slowloris”攻击通过发送不完整的HTTP请求,保持大量连接耗尽服务器资源。

Apache安全漏洞如何修复?有哪些最新防护措施?

Apache漏洞的影响范围与典型案例

Apache漏洞的影响范围取决于其部署场景,若服务器托管关键业务(如电商、金融系统),漏洞可能直接导致数据泄露、财产损失;若用于内部服务,可能成为攻击内网的跳板,以下是近年来影响较大的典型案例:

漏洞编号 漏洞类型 影响版本 潜在影响 修复时间
CVE-2021-41773 路径穿越/代码执行 Apache 2.4.49 服务器文件读取、代码执行 2021年10月
CVE-2022-22720 权限绕过 Apache APISIX 2.15.0 绕过认证访问管理接口 2022年3月
CVE-2021-40438 远程代码执行 Apache DolphinScheduler 任务调度器被控,服务器沦陷 2021年8月
CVE-2020-1938 信息泄露/代码执行 Apache Tomcat 9.0.0M1+ 敏感信息泄露、代码执行 2020年3月

Apache安全防护核心措施

及时更新与版本管理

官方安全公告是漏洞修复的首要来源,管理员需定期检查Apache官网或漏洞平台(如CVE、NVD),及时升级到最新稳定版本,对于无法立即升级的场景,可通过官方补丁临时修复高危漏洞。

配置安全加固

  • 禁用不必要模块:关闭未使用的模块(如mod_autoindex、mod_info),减少攻击面;
  • 限制目录访问:通过.htaccess或主配置文件禁用目录列表,设置Options -Indexes
  • 配置访问控制:利用Require指令限制IP访问,或结合LDAP、OAuth实现身份认证;
  • 错误页面定制:关闭详细错误信息,避免泄露服务器版本和路径。

输入验证与输出编码

对所有用户输入(如URL参数、表单数据)进行严格校验,过滤特殊字符(如、<script>),对于动态页面输出,采用HTML实体编码或参数化查询,防止XSS和SQL注入。

部署WAF与入侵检测

通过Web应用防火墙(如ModSecurity)拦截恶意请求,例如规则SecRule ARGS "@contains ../" "deny"可阻止路径穿越攻击,结合IDS(如Snort)监控异常流量,及时发现攻击行为。

日志监控与审计

启用Apache的访问日志(access_log)和错误日志(error_log),定期分析日志中的异常请求(如高频404错误、长连接请求),利用ELK(Elasticsearch、Logstash、Kibana)或Splunk实现日志集中分析,提升威胁发现效率。

Apache安全漏洞如何修复?有哪些最新防护措施?

应急响应与漏洞修复流程

当Apache漏洞被利用时,需按以下步骤快速响应:

  1. 隔离受影响系统:断开网络连接,防止攻击扩散;
  2. 备份与取证:保留服务器日志、配置文件及内存快照,用于后续溯源;
  3. 应用修复方案:升级版本或打补丁,验证修复效果;
  4. 全面检测:通过漏洞扫描工具(如Nessus、OpenVAS)检查是否存在其他关联漏洞;
  5. 总结与优化:分析漏洞成因,更新安全策略,加强员工培训。

Apache安全漏洞的防护是一个持续的过程,需结合技术手段与管理措施,管理员需保持对安全动态的关注,遵循“最小权限、纵深防御”原则,定期进行安全评估,才能有效降低漏洞风险,保障Web服务的安全稳定运行。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/25551.html

(0)
上一篇 2025年10月24日 10:34
下一篇 2025年10月24日 10:43

相关推荐

  • 阜阳市云主机价格如何?性价比最高的云主机推荐是哪款?

    阜阳市云主机价格解析与选购指南云主机,即云服务器,是一种基于云计算技术的虚拟服务器,它具有高可用性、弹性伸缩、按需付费等特点,被广泛应用于网站、应用、数据存储等领域,在阜阳市,云主机已成为企业、个人用户提升IT服务能力的重要选择,阜阳市云主机价格构成带宽费用:带宽是云主机的重要参数之一,它决定了数据传输的速度……

    2026年1月18日
    0310
  • 昆明服务器租用,性价比高吗?哪家服务商更值得信赖?

    高效稳定的云端解决方案昆明服务器租用概述随着互联网的快速发展,越来越多的企业和个人开始关注服务器租用服务,昆明作为我国西南地区的重要城市,拥有丰富的网络资源和优越的地理位置,成为众多企业选择服务器租用的理想之地,本文将为您详细介绍昆明服务器租用的优势、类型以及如何选择合适的服务器租用方案,昆明服务器租用优势丰富……

    2025年11月13日
    0280
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 服务器用户名默认是什么?如何修改默认用户名?

    安全风险与管理最佳实践在服务器管理中,用户名作为身份认证的第一道防线,其默认设置往往被忽视,许多服务器在初始部署时会使用默认用户名,这一看似便捷的做法却潜藏着巨大的安全风险,本文将深入探讨服务器默认用户名的风险、常见类型、影响范围以及相应的管理策略,帮助用户构建更安全的服务器环境,默认用户名的常见类型与来源服务……

    2025年12月15日
    0800
  • 服务器计算机最重要的特征有哪些?关键性能指标是什么?

    服务器计算机作为现代信息社会的核心基础设施,其重要性不言而喻,与普通个人计算机不同,服务器的设计初衷是为了高效、稳定、安全地处理海量数据和提供各类服务,因此其具备了一系列独特而关键的特征,这些特征共同决定了服务器在各类应用场景中的性能表现和可靠性,是支撑云计算、大数据、人工智能等前沿技术发展的基石,以下将从多个……

    2025年12月2日
    0610

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注